Definitions and Meaning of exemption in English

Wordnet

exemption (n)

immunity from an obligation or duty

a deduction allowed to a taxpayer because of his status (having certain dependents or being blind or being over 65 etc.)

an act exempting someone

Webster

exemption (n.)

The act of exempting; the state of being exempt; freedom from any charge, burden, evil, etc., to which others are subject; immunity; privilege; as, exemption of certain articles from seizure; exemption from military service; exemption from anxiety, suffering, etc.
